Could you be the full-time Industrial Controller in Toronto, ON we're looking for?
Your future roleTake on a new challenge and apply your financial and operational expertise in a dynamic and innovative industry. You'll work alongside a collaborative, detail-oriented, and forward-thinking team.
You'll play a pivotal role in ensuring financial accuracy and operational efficiency across a variety of critical projects. Day-to-day, you'll work closely with teams across the business (such as Operations, Procurement, and Project Management), analyze financial data to support decision-making, and ensure compliance with financial and operational standards.
You'll specifically take care of tracking production and installation costs and monitoring variances, but also support the financial substantiation required for cost-plus billing and ensure compliance with Alstom's finance rules and contractual obligations.
We'll look to you for:- Tracking production and installation costs for all Oncorr scopes
- Monitoring variances versus baseline: labour, material, subcontracting, logistics
- Validating operational inputs for monthly forecasts (cost-to-complete, margin, cash)
- Ensuring proper cost allocation across work packages, cost centers, and customer invoices
- Supporting the financial substantiation required for cost-plus billing
- Monitoring incoming materials, warehouse movements, and consumption
- Ensuring accurate BOM tracking to support open-book cost transparency
- Tracking operational KPIs: productivity, installation progress, subcontractor performance, equipment utilization, rework/defects
- Providing insights and analytics to improve operational efficiency
- Ensuring transparency, traceability, and audit-ready documentation for all operational costs
- Acting as the financial focal point for installation and production managers
- Supporting the Project Finance Director with inputs for claims, variations, and contractual negotiations
